Logistics and transportation of prefabricated structures, commonly referred to as prefabs, involve the planning, execution, and management of the movement of these structures from manufacturing facilities to construction sites. Prefabs are factory-built components that are assembled on-site, making them an efficient alternative to traditional building methods. The logistics process addresses the complex requirements of transporting large, often modular sections, ensuring they arrive intact and ready for installation.
The primary uses of logistics and transportation for prefabs include residential buildings, commercial spaces, and industrial facilities. These structures are increasingly popular due to their speed of construction and cost efficiency. Businesses benefit from reduced labor costs and shorter timelines, making prefabs an attractive option in various sectors such as construction, real estate development, and emergency housing solutions.

Logistics and transportation of prefabs encompass several key features that ensure the efficient delivery and installation of prefabricated structures. Understanding these specifications is crucial for businesses looking to optimize their supply chain.
Key specifications include:
1. Transportation Method
- Options include road, rail, and maritime transport.
- Selection depends on the size and destination of the prefab.
2. Load Capacity
- Refers to the maximum weight the transport vehicle can carry.
- Critical for ensuring safety and compliance during transportation.
3. Packaging Standards
- Specifications on how prefabs are packaged for transit.
- Must protect against weather and physical damage.
4. Delivery Times
- Estimated timeframes for transportation from manufacturer to site.
- Varies based on distance and logistics provider.
5. Communication Protocols
- Established processes for tracking and updating shipment status.
- Ensures transparency and timely information flow.
6. Compliance Requirements
- Adherence to local and international transportation regulations.
- Essential for avoiding legal issues during transit.
7. Environmental Controls
- Systems in place to monitor conditions during transport.
- Important for sensitive materials that require specific temperature or humidity levels.
In summary, the logistics and transportation of prefabs involve various specifications that ensure safe and efficient delivery. Companies must consider these factors when selecting their logistics partners.

Logistics and transportation of prefabs find applications across multiple industries, demonstrating their versatility and efficiency.
1. Construction: Prefabs are commonly used in residential and commercial projects, allowing for rapid assembly and reduced labor costs.
2. Disaster Relief: Prefabricated structures can be quickly transported and assembled in disaster-stricken areas, providing immediate shelter and facilities.
3. Healthcare: Modular medical facilities can be rapidly deployed to meet urgent healthcare needs during crises or expansions.
4. Education: Prefab classrooms can be set up quickly to accommodate growing student populations or to replace damaged structures.
5. Hospitality: Prefabricated hotels and lodges can be constructed swiftly, offering flexibility in design and placement.
6. Industrial: Prefab warehouses and factories allow businesses to expand operations without extensive downtime.
7. Retail: Modular retail spaces can be erected quickly to meet market demands and seasonal fluctuations.

Logistics and transportation of prefabs provide numerous benefits that enhance operational efficiency and cost-effectiveness.
Key benefits include:
1. Time Efficiency: Prefabricated structures can be constructed faster, significantly reducing project timelines.
2. Cost Savings: Lower labor and material costs contribute to overall savings, making prefabs a financially viable option.
3. Enhanced Quality Control: Factory-built components are subject to stringent quality standards, ensuring consistent outcomes.
4. Flexibility: Modular designs allow for easy modifications and expansions, adapting to changing requirements.
5. Reduced Waste: Prefabs minimize waste during construction, aligning with sustainable building practices.
6. Simplified Supply Chain: Streamlined logistics reduce the complexity of transporting large structures, improving delivery reliability.
